Going on a date should be exciting,
fun, and interesting. However, sometimes you may not ask the right questions.
The right questions are opened-ended. They allow for conversation; and as a
result you learn more about the other person. What you don’t want to do is ask
closed-ended questions because they don’t allow for conversation. They’re more
abrupt and lead to short conversation. These include questions like: what do
you do for a living? Do you like fruits? Do you like the beach? Each one of
those questions could be answered with a single statement, or a few words; and
that is not what you want if you’re interested in someone. A date is to find
out more about how someone thinks, behaves, and responds to certain things you
do, and say. So, if you aren’t very good at asking opened-ended question here
are some you can use. These will also help you make your own.
